Most of us have been to many museums. Some of them, however, stand out for their originality. Like the Museum of Historical Motorcycles in Nicosia, Cyprus. An effort of a private individual, that counts over 30 years, can only impress the visitor. Especially if he’s a fan of 2-wheel vehicles.
The Museum was founded by Andreas Nikolaou and the result of all this great effort is, to have a hundred and fifty motorcycles gathered in a place in Nicosia today. In the museum, you will see motorcycles from 1914 to 1983, such as AJS, MATCHLESS, NORTONS, BSA, MV AGUSTA, TRIUMPH, ARIEL, BMW, MOTO GUZZI, JAMES, ROYAL ENFIELD and many others.
The diamonds available in the Museum of Historical Motorcycle

Some of the motorcycles in the Museum undoubtedly steal the show. There, you will see three police motorcycles that accompanied Archbishop Makarios. Also on display is the motorcycle of EOKA hero Stylianos Lenas, which he had used to transport weapons and ammunition. In the Museum of Historical Motorcycle the motorcycle of the first champion in Cyprus in 1970-1973 Turkish Cypriot Zeki Isa, is also there. Among the many exhibits, there are also World War II military motorcycles as well as other models.

Walking into the museum and seeing its photographic archive available, one can relive old times. Back when the motorcycle was the main means of transportation. It is a special cultural heritage of Cyprus in this area. If you are in Nicosia, it is worth seeing it up close.
Where to find the Museum in Nicosia
The Museum of Historical Motorcycle is located at 44 Granikos Street in Old Nicosia.
Opening Hours:
• Monday – Friday: 09.00 – 13.00, 15.00 – 18.00 (summer until 20.00)
• Saturday: 09.00 – 13.00
